Things To Do
in Holalu
Holalu is a quaint village located in the southern part of India, known for its rich cultural heritage and stunning natural landscapes. Surrounded by lush greenery and rolling hills, it offers a peaceful escape from the hustle and bustle of larger cities. The village is famous for its traditional architecture and vibrant local festivals that showcase the community's art and music.
Visitors can experience the warmth of local hospitality and the simplicity of rural life while exploring the scenic beauty of the region.

How to Behave
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ior
Always remove shoes before entering temples and be respectful of religious customs.
A polite greeting with a smile is appreciated; using 'Namaste' is a common practice.
Especially in rural areas and religious places, wearing modest clothing is advised.
